Rapid Roll High Speed Doors Meet Challenges of Fresh Produce Manufacturing

The Australian Trellis Door Company (ATDC) offers a range of rapid roll high speed doors suitable for use in fresh produce manufacturing, logistics and cold storage.

Ideal Doors for Fresh Produce Warehouse by ATDC

Rapid Roll Door
High Speed Door

Consider the challenges faced by a large scale producer of fresh produce. Take fruit as an example. Such facilities generally consist of processing areas, storage coolers, and cold loading docks. The cold loading docks need to be kept at specific temperatures. Storage coolers within the loading dock areas need to be kept at different temperatures to ensure product integrity. All areas need to be accessed by forklifts through numerous doorways. The processing area needs to be kept at another temperature, at a lower humidity level than the others, to prevent food from “sweating” i.e. condensation that can spoil the food.

 

Separating Areas Effectively

These different areas of the building need to be separated to help control temperature and humidity. Rapid roll high speed doors are a perfect solution. They operate quickly (high cycle time) preventing a large amount of warm air entering these areas when the doors are activated. This in turn lowers energy costs. The fabric of the doors also plays an important role in temperature and humidity control, and hygiene.

 

Easy and Safe Access

These doors can employ motion sensors to activate the doors if a forklift is approaching. This ensures forklifts don’t bump into them and damage them, requiring produce to be quickly moved to different locations of suitable temperature. What’s more, certain rapid roll high speed doors can withstand impact from e.g. forklifts, meaning that if a forklift drives into these doors, they can reload themselves back into their tracks and continue operating as normal.  This minimises costly maintenance and downtime.

Security Shutters for Poker Machines in Bowling Club Gaming Rooms

The Australian Trellis Door Company (ATDC) recently installed custom expandable security gates at Kurri Kurri Bowling Club, located near Cessnock in the Hunter Valley, NSW. These shutters serve to protect the club’s poker machines within its gaming rooms while also aiding in compliance with NSW smoking laws.

ATDC Installs Expandable Security Shutters at Kurri Kurri Bowling Club

Security Shutters
Security shutters for poker machines in bowling club gaming rooms

 

Balancing Security and Compliance with Smoking Law

The need for secure shutters arose not only to safeguard the club’s valuable poker machines but also to comply with NSW smoking legislation. NSW laws require that designated smoking areas in licensed premises be open to the outdoors to allow smoke to dissipate efficiently.

 

Precision-Engineered, Custom Solutions

ATDC designed, engineered, and custom-made each shutter specifically to fit the designated apertures within the club’s gaming rooms. Each security shutter is top-hung from strong RHS steel structural members, which were also designed, supplied, and installed by ATDC. The shutters were powder-coated in a sleek black satin finish to complement the club’s existing décor.

 

Ventilation, Visibility, and Security Combined

These expandable security shutters offer full ventilation, thanks to their open-grille design with mesh infills. This ensures compliance with smoking laws while maintaining a secure barrier for the gaming machines. When not in use, the shutters conveniently fold away, occupying only 15% of their fully expanded width, maximising space efficiency. Fully framed, lockable, and secure, they provide a robust solution for protecting assets without compromising on airflow or aesthetics.

INNOVATIVE TRIPLE TRACK COMMERCIAL BIFOLD DOOR HAS INCREDIBLE SPACE SAVING BENEFITS

The Australian Trellis Door Company (ATDC) has pioneered a triple-track commercial bifold door system or scissor doors that achieves major storage space advantages for its customers.

ATDC’s Triple Track Commercial Bifold Door System

security bifold shopfront door brisbane
Side by Side bifold door for shopfront

Efficient Design for Maximum Retail Frontage

In a recent commercial fitout project for Natalie Marie Jewellery at Avalon in Sydney, Annandale-based interior architect X+O specified an S07-2 side-by-side parallel top track arrangement for ATDC’s commercial bifold door at the front of the retail store. The design intent was to minimise the side stacking depth of the door, providing maximum retail frontage for the client. Read further product information and technical details. about our triple track, commercial bifold door.

 

Overcoming Storage Space Limitations Onsite

Once onsite, the project manager, LJW Building, encountered further door storage space limitations, requiring a maximum stack depth of 8% of the shopfront span. To meet this requirement, ATDC installed its bifold door in a triple top track configuration, achieving a door stack of just 450mm over a 5700mm shopfront opening span. This incredible achievement is essential for retailers and commercial businesses aiming to maximise their trading space in high-rent properties.

 

Seamless Lock-Up and No Floor Track Required

The triple-track system offers seamless lock-up with a series of intermittent up/down locking mechanisms, requiring no floor track or removable mullions. The attached image demonstrates the successful setup of this recent installation.

QUALITY CONCERTINA SHUTTERS GAIN MARKET TRACTION

The Australian Trellis Door Company’s (ATDC) Permashield concertina shutters are gaining significant market penetration both in the commercial and retail markets.

ATDC Provides Shutters for Specsavers and More Brands Globally

Specsavers Concertina Folding Door

Specsavers Project

The above photograph shows a recent installation at Specsavers Moonee Ponds, Victoria, which follows on from other installations for this global brand. Here, the project manager was from Australasian Retail Projects out of Queensland. The door was powder-coated in a special colour bright silver metallic finish, to meet the requirements of Moonee Ponds Central Shopping Centre.

 

What Did We Specify for the Project?

These quality, precision engineered permashield concertina doors are constructed from extruded aluminium panel sections with interlocking heavy duty hinges and roller bearings which allow the curtain to easily slide and retract whilst suspended from a heavy duty aluminium top track. Available in either a wide body 300mm panel or slimline section 150mm, the shutters are user friendly and look the goods with their smooth lines and sleek aesthetic design.

 

Ease of Use

They offer the operator seamless lock up options with intermediate up/down locking mechanisms and without the need for any floor track with its attendant trip hazard disadvantages. With maximum height at approximately 4500mm, curtain infill options include either 3mm polycarbonate, perforated mesh or solid aluminium depending on the application.

Curved configurations are quite a regular application including special radius turns and S-bends.

The History of Radio Rentals

Radio Rentals was formed in 1930 in Brighton, Sussex, UK, with a turnover in the first year of £780. It later moved into televisions and ultimately video recorders. Growth of a public TV service after the war encouraged more people to want TV sets, but they were expensive, leaving an opportunity for Radio Rentals to offer them out as an affordable monthly rental. Video recorders and a range of white goods came next as the business took off.

 

The Radio Rentals Story in Australia

The Radio Rentals story in Australia began with a single shopfront in Market Street, Sydney, in 1937. Today, it is Australia’s leading household appliance, technology, and furniture rental company, with over 70 stores in Australia and nearly 30 stores in New Zealand and more than 500 employees. The parent company is Thorn Group Limited.

EXTENDABLE SAFETY BARRIERS AT GREEN SQUARE LIBRARY ARE BCA EGRESS COMPLIANT

The City of Sydney is working with leading private developers to create a new and sustainable £13 billion, 14-hectare urban renewal project, Green Square, with world-class community facilities and extensive infrastructure. ATDC provided extendable safety barriers to the new library. 

ATDC Trusted by the City of Sydney to Provide Safety Barriers to Green Square

It is projected that by 2030 Green Square will house 61,000 people and 22,000 new workers, only 3.5 km from the CBD in Sydney’s Inner South and 4 km from the International Airport at Mascot.

 

Green Square Library Benefits from ATDC Security

A small part of this investment includes construction of a new community library, and The Australian Trellis Door Company (ATDC) has recently installed one of its unique extendable safety barriers at the library entry.

Specified by Sydney architect, Stewart Hollenstein, ATDC worked closely with project managers John Holland in delivering a custom-made lock-up door solution to this prestigious project. ATDC’s S04-1 DD Double Diamond mesh extendable safety barrier was the door of choice for the project architect since it provided a freestanding yet economic security solution and was able to be installed in the absence of any available support structure.

 

Compliant with Rigorous Standards Worldwide

In addition, ATDC’s unique barriers not only comply with the Australian Standards for Temporary Fencing and Hoardings but are also compliant with the emergency egress requirements of the BCA, allowing keyless egress in the event of an emergency. Being installed at the entry to the public library, it was essential that this emergency egress facility was incorporated into the design of the barrier system. ATDC installed a similar system for the State Transit Authority at Barangaroo at the entry to the new ferry terminal.

 

Library Project Specifications

The crowd control barrier system was installed at the foot of the stairs to the library entry and was formatted in a U-shaped configuration to completely surround the balustrading on the stairs. (See photograph of the installation above).

Supplied at a standard height of 2020 mm, the mobile and portable extendable safety barrier was installed on a series of heavy-duty non-marking thermoplastic castors and was finished in a satin black powder coat. Intermediate shoot bolts, which engage with the finished floor, were used to stabilise the barrier system.

Crowd Control Barriers For Transit Centres Increasingly Required

A major expansion of railway stations in both Sydney and Melbourne Transit Centres has resulted in a mushrooming of valuable new retail floor space. 

 

The Australian Trellis Door Company (ATDC)’s industry leading crowd control barriers are the go-to product for securing retail space in these transit hubs — whether for airports, railway stations or hospital-retail storefronts.

 

ATDC Barriers Trusted for Major Spaces Across Sydney and Melbourne

 

Crowd Control Barriers For Transit Centres on the rise Sydney Wyndard Central Lines Australia Trellis Doors Co
Crowd Control Barriers at Train Stations

In Sydney, major train station expansions at Wynyard, Central, Barrangaroo and the Northwest Metro Line are typical examples of this fairly recent phenomenon.(See article by Carolyn Cummins.) Similarly, airports and hospitals (transit hubs with a captive market) are proving to be the new frontier for retailers.

ATDC has supplied its crowd control barriers to secure permanent and pop-up retail at Central Station and Wynyard as well as securing thousands of square metres of retail space at both Sydney and Melbourne International and Domestic Airports.

 

Ease of Use and Compliance with OH+S

ATDC’s crowd control barriers are safe and easy to operate, having been tested against the relevant OH+S legislation and NATA tested against the Australian Standards for Temporary Fencing and Hoarding. This includes dynamic impact testing and simulated climbing.

 

Amenities for Modern Businesses

These crowd control barriers are trackless, portable and flexible. Since they are modular, they can span unlimited width apertures (at any angle) without the need for any removable mullions.

Available in standard heights, they run on a series of heavy-duty non-marking thermoplastic bottom castors and have numerous wall-mounted and floor-fixed locking options.
